The Los Angeles Sparks secured a hard-fought 84-81 victory over the Washington Mystics in a down-to-the-wire WNBA matchup that showcased elite perimeter shooting and high-stakes defensive execution. A decisive fourth-quarter run propelled Los Angeles ahead, leaving Washington empty-handed despite a stellar individual performance from their starting backcourt.

Defensive Clamps and Late-Game Execution Drive LA Victory

The matchup hinged on critical tactical adjustments made during the closing five minutes of regulation. Washington relied heavily on their transition offense in the first half, pushing the pace to build a three-point lead at halftime behind explosive drives and quick ball movement.

However, Los Angeles altered their defensive coverage late in the third quarter, switching to a high-pressure hedge on pick-and-roll possessions. The Sparks forced six critical turnovers during the final period, converting those mistakes into 11 fast-break points down the stretch.



  • Key Run: A 10-2 run by the Sparks between the 6:00 and 2:30 mark in the fourth quarter turned a three-point deficit into a commanding lead.
  • Clutch Free Throws: Los Angeles sank five consecutive free throws in the final minute to keep the game just out of Washington's reach.
  • Paint Dominance: The Sparks outscored the Mystics 42-32 in the paint, utilizing superior size down low during late-shot-clock situations.

Inside the Analytics and Where to Watch Game Replays

A closer look at the advanced box score reveals stark contrasts in offensive efficiency. While the Mystics shot a respectable 44.8% from the field, their struggles at the free-throw line (11-of-18, 61.1%) ultimately proved costly in a tight three-point loss.

Conversely, the Sparks displayed remarkable ball security, committing just nine turnovers all evening while distributing 21 assists on 31 made field goals. Their bench unit also outscored Washington’s reserves 26-14, providing vital relief during a physical second half.
